#763098 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#763098 is composed of 46.3% red, 18.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.4% cyan, 68.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 280.4 degrees, a saturation of 52% and a lightness of 39.2%. #763098 color hex could be obtained by blending #ec60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#763098 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#763098 has RGB values of R:118, G:48,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.22,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 7745688.
| Hex triplet | 763098 | #763098 |
|---|---|---|
| RGB Decimal | 118, 48, 152 | rgb(118,48,152) |
| RGB Percent | 46.3, 18.8, 59.6 | rgb(46.3%,18.8%,59.6%) |
| CMYK | 22, 68, 0, 40 | |
| HSL | 280.4°, 52, 39.2 | hsl(280.4,52%,39.2%) |
| HSV (or HSB) | 280.4°, 68.4, 59.6 | |
| Web Safe | 663399 | #663399 |
| CIE-LAB | 34.463, 47.764, -43.92 |
|---|---|
| XYZ | 14.195, 8.233, 30.545 |
| xyY | 0.268, 0.155, 8.233 |
| CIE-LCH | 34.463, 64.887, 317.401 |
| CIE-LUV | 34.463, 22.291, -65.067 |
| Hunter-Lab | 28.693, 38.094, -43.033 |
| Binary | 01110110, 00110000, 10011000 |
